Pentagon: Kirby addresses AOIMSG status and upcoming Congressional UAP hearing

On May 10, 2022, Pentagon Press Secretary John F. Kirby held a briefing where he discussed the forthcoming Congressional hearing on UFOs. He also provided updates on the Airborne Object Identification and Management Synchronization Group (AOIMSG), the Department of Defense's new effort to study unidentified aerial phenomena.

Background

The Pentagon's top spokesperson addressed journalists regarding two significant developments in the UAP disclosure process, as documented by TheBlackVault.com. His remarks came one week before the first Congressional hearing on UFOs in decades, scheduled for May 17, 2022.

Kirby outlined the current operational status of the Airborne Object Identification and Management Synchronization Group (AOIMSG). This organization represents the Defense Department's latest formal structure for investigating military encounters with unidentified objects.
